Xanh SM to deploy 1,300 EVs and 1,000 chargers in Nghe An

The partnership with CK Vietnam and V-Green aims to expand the electric mobility ecosystem in the province.

On June 21, 2025, Xanh SM, V-Green (both part of the Vingroup ecosystem), and CK Vietnam JSC announced a cooperation to develop a fully electric transport model in Nghe An province. The plan includes the deployment of 300 electric buses, 1,000 electric cars, and the installation of 1,000 charging points.

Under the agreement, Xanh SM will provide CK Vietnam with 300 Ebus electric buses to operate the first green public transport routes in the province. These buses are equipped with active monitoring systems, smart travel displays, integrated Wi-Fi, and deliver a quiet, zero-emission ride to improve air quality and passenger experience.

The project’s initial focus includes interprovincial routes, particularly between Nghe An and Ha Tinh, which CK aims to launch as early as Q3 2025.

In addition to the buses, Xanh SM will supply 1,000 electric vehicles for commercial transport services. The fleet includes:

VinFast Limo Green for interprovincial travel and premium tourism.

Herio Green for standard taxi services.

EC Van, a compact electric truck for urban deliveries.

All services operated by CK Vietnam will be integrated into the Xanh SM mobile app, enabling users to book, track, and pay seamlessly. The platform will also support CK’s operational efficiency through nationwide system integration.

Charging infrastructure with V-Green

In parallel with the delivery of 1,300 electric vehicles, CK Vietnam will partner with V-Green Global Charging Station Development to build a network of 1,000 chargers across strategic locations in Nghe An.

The charging points will be deployed at shopping centres, bus terminals, residential areas, and along key economic corridors. All stations will utilize smart dispatching technology to support the province’s shift toward a sustainable energy infrastructure.

Speaking at the signing ceremony, Nguyen Van Thanh, CEO of GSM Global, emphasized: “This is not just a commercial transaction but a strategic move in Vietnam’s national transition to green transport.”

Nguyen Thanh Duong, CEO of V-Green, added: “Charging infrastructure plays a central role in any electrified transport ecosystem. We are committed to working with CK Vietnam and Xanh SM to deploy 1,000 chargers swiftly and ensure long-term operational stability.”

Nguyen Van Ket, Chairman of CK Vietnam, stated: “This cooperation gives us access to cutting-edge technology and efficient operations, contributing to Nghe An’s sustainable and civilised development.”

The alliance between Xanh SM, V-Green, and CK Vietnam is part of a broader effort by Vingroup-affiliated companies to scale up zero-emission transport networks nationwide, supporting Vietnam’s long-term sustainability goals.
